Church Ramp Installation in Conroe, TX
Church ramp installation services provide accessible solutions for property owners seeking to improve entryways for individuals with mobility challenges. These projects typically involve constructing or installing ramps that connect the ground level to entrances of churches, community centers, or private residences, ensuring safe and convenient access. Homeowners often request these services to accommodate visitors, congregation members, or family members who use wheelchairs, walkers, or have difficulty navigating stairs. Before requesting installation, property owners should consider factors such as the location of the entrance, available space for the ramp, and the preferred materials to ensure the structure meets accessibility needs and complements the property’s aesthetic.
Understanding the scope of a church ramp installation involves evaluating the specific requirements of the property, including the incline, size, and durability of the ramp. Property owners typically want to know about the different types of ramps available-such as portable, modular, or custom-built options-and how they can best suit the property’s layout. It’s also important to consider local building codes and safety standards, as well as any aesthetic preferences.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the completed project provides safe, functional, and visually appropriate access for everyone.

Church Ramp Installation Questions
What types of properties typically need a church ramp? Properties with steps or uneven surfaces that hinder wheelchair or stroller access often require a church ramp.
What materials are used for church ramp installation?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and composite options, chosen for durability and suitability to the property.
Are there different styles of church ramps available? Yes, ramps can be customized in various styles, including straight, L-shaped, or ramp with landings, to fit different property layouts.
What should property owners consider before installing a church ramp? It’s important to evaluate the location, accessibility needs, and local building codes to ensure proper installation and safety.
